2,279 Predictive Models jobs in Kenya
Junior Data Scientist - Predictive Modeling
Posted 14 days ago
Job Viewed
Job Description
Responsibilities:
- Assist in data collection, cleaning, and preprocessing from various sources.
- Perform exploratory data analysis (EDA) to identify trends and patterns.
- Develop, train, and evaluate machine learning models under supervision.
- Assist in feature engineering and selection for predictive models.
- Collaborate with senior data scientists on data visualization and reporting.
- Conduct statistical analysis to support findings.
- Document methodologies, findings, and code.
- Learn and apply new data science techniques and tools.
- Participate in team meetings and contribute ideas for data-driven solutions.
- Support the deployment and monitoring of models as needed.
- Currently pursuing or recently completed a Bachelor's or Master's degree in Data Science, Statistics, Computer Science, Mathematics, or a related quantitative field.
- Foundational knowledge of statistical concepts and machine learning algorithms.
- Proficiency in programming languages commonly used in data science, such as Python or R.
- Experience with data manipulation libraries (e.g., Pandas, NumPy).
- Familiarity with data visualization tools (e.g., Matplotlib, Seaborn).
- Basic understanding of databases and SQL.
- Strong analytical and problem-solving skills.
- Excellent communication and teamwork abilities, suitable for remote collaboration.
- Eagerness to learn and adapt to new technologies.
- A genuine interest in data science and its applications.
AI & Machine Learning Lead - Predictive Modeling
Posted 19 days ago
Job Viewed
Job Description
Senior Data Scientist - Predictive Modeling
Posted 19 days ago
Job Viewed
Job Description
- Design, develop, and implement advanced machine learning models for predictive analytics, forecasting, and anomaly detection.
- Collaborate with stakeholders across various departments to identify business challenges and opportunities for data science solutions.
- Perform data exploration, cleaning, and feature engineering on large, complex datasets.
- Select appropriate algorithms and statistical methods to address specific research questions and business objectives.
- Validate model performance, interpret results, and communicate findings effectively to both technical and non-technical audiences.
- Develop and maintain robust data pipelines for model training and deployment.
- Stay abreast of the latest research and advancements in data science, machine learning, and artificial intelligence.
- Contribute to the development of scalable data science infrastructure and tools.
- Mentor junior data scientists and contribute to the growth of the data science community within the organization.
- Document methodologies, code, and results thoroughly.
- Present research findings and recommendations to senior leadership and cross-functional teams.
- Identify new data sources and methodologies to enhance predictive capabilities.
- Master's or Ph.D. in Computer Science, Statistics, Mathematics, Physics, or a related quantitative field.
- Minimum of 5 years of experience in data science, with a strong focus on predictive modeling and machine learning.
- Proficiency in programming languages such as Python or R, and relevant data science libraries (e.g., scikit-learn, TensorFlow, PyTorch, pandas, NumPy).
- Extensive experience with statistical modeling, machine learning algorithms (e.g., regression, classification, clustering, deep learning), and validation techniques.
- Experience working with large datasets and distributed computing frameworks (e.g., Spark) is desirable.
- Strong understanding of data structures, algorithms, and software development best practices.
- Excellent problem-solving, analytical, and critical thinking skills.
- Strong communication and presentation skills, with the ability to explain complex concepts clearly.
- Ability to work independently and collaboratively in a remote research environment.
- Experience with cloud platforms (AWS, Azure, GCP) is a plus.
Senior AI/ML Engineer - Predictive Modeling
Posted 10 days ago
Job Viewed
Job Description
Responsibilities:
- Design, develop, and implement state-of-the-art machine learning models and algorithms for predictive analytics.
- Build and maintain scalable ML pipelines for data ingestion, feature engineering, model training, and deployment.
- Conduct rigorous experimentation and validation of models to ensure accuracy, robustness, and performance.
- Collaborate with data scientists and software engineers to integrate ML models into production systems.
- Research and apply new AI/ML techniques and technologies to solve complex business problems.
- Optimize existing models for improved efficiency, speed, and resource utilization.
- Develop and maintain comprehensive documentation for ML models and processes.
- Stay abreast of the latest advancements in AI, machine learning, and deep learning research.
- Mentor junior engineers and contribute to the team's knowledge sharing and technical growth.
- Communicate complex technical concepts clearly to both technical and non-technical stakeholders.
- Ph.D. or Master's degree in Computer Science, Artificial Intelligence, Statistics, Mathematics, or a related quantitative field.
- 5+ years of hands-on experience in developing and deploying machine learning models in production environments.
- Proficiency in Python and common ML libraries/frameworks (e.g., TensorFlow, PyTorch, Scikit-learn).
- Strong understanding of algorithms, data structures, and statistical modeling.
- Experience with cloud platforms (AWS, Azure, GCP) and ML services.
- Experience with big data technologies (e.g., Spark, Hadoop) is a plus.
- Excellent problem-solving and analytical skills.
- Strong communication and collaboration skills, with the ability to work effectively in a remote team.
- Published research or contributions to open-source ML projects are highly desirable.
- This position is 100% remote, offering a unique opportunity to work on groundbreaking AI projects without geographical constraints.
Remote AI/ML Engineer - Predictive Modeling
Posted 16 days ago
Job Viewed
Job Description
Responsibilities:
- Design, develop, and implement machine learning models and algorithms.
- Perform data mining, feature engineering, and data preprocessing for model training.
- Evaluate and optimize model performance using various metrics.
- Deploy machine learning models into production environments.
- Collaborate with data scientists and software engineers to integrate AI solutions.
- Conduct research on state-of-the-art AI/ML techniques and algorithms.
- Build and maintain data pipelines for ML workflows.
- Troubleshoot and debug model performance issues.
- Develop and maintain documentation for AI/ML projects.
- Stay current with advancements in AI, machine learning, and deep learning.
- Contribute to the company's intellectual property through innovation.
- Present technical findings and insights to cross-functional teams.
- Master's degree or Ph.D. in Computer Science, Data Science, Artificial Intelligence, or a related quantitative field.
- 5+ years of hands-on experience in developing and deploying machine learning models.
- Proficiency in programming languages such as Python or R.
- Experience with ML libraries and frameworks (e.g., TensorFlow, PyTorch, Scikit-learn).
- Strong understanding of statistical modeling, algorithms, and data structures.
- Experience with cloud platforms (AWS, Azure, GCP) and MLOps practices is a plus.
- Excellent analytical, problem-solving, and critical thinking skills.
- Strong communication and collaboration abilities in a remote setting.
- Ability to work independently and manage complex projects.
- Experience with big data technologies (e.g., Spark) is beneficial.
Remote Graduate Data Analyst - AI & Machine Learning Focus
Posted 4 days ago
Job Viewed
Job Description
Responsibilities:
- Assist in the collection, cleaning, and preprocessing of diverse datasets from various sources.
- Perform exploratory data analysis (EDA) to identify trends, patterns, and anomalies.
- Develop and implement basic machine learning models under the guidance of senior team members.
- Visualize data and model results using tools such as Python libraries (Matplotlib, Seaborn) or Tableau.
- Collaborate with data scientists and engineers on feature engineering and model selection.
- Document methodologies, findings, and code for reproducibility and knowledge sharing.
- Participate in regular team meetings and contribute to project discussions.
- Learn and apply new data analysis techniques and tools relevant to AI/ML.
- Assist in the testing and validation of AI/ML models.
- Contribute to the overall data strategy and innovation efforts.
Qualifications:
- Recent graduate with a Bachelor's or Master's degree in Statistics, Mathematics, Computer Science, Economics, Engineering, or a related quantitative field.
- Foundational understanding of statistical concepts and data analysis techniques.
- Basic programming skills in Python or R, including experience with relevant data manipulation and analysis libraries (e.g., Pandas, NumPy).
- Familiarity with machine learning concepts and algorithms is highly desirable.
- Exposure to data visualization tools.
- Strong analytical and problem-solving abilities.
- Excellent communication and teamwork skills, essential for remote collaboration.
- Proactive attitude and eagerness to learn and take on new challenges.
- Self-motivated and able to manage tasks effectively in a remote environment.
- A genuine interest in AI and Machine Learning.
This paid internship offers invaluable experience in a rapidly growing field, providing mentorship and real project involvement. The role is fully remote, supporting our strategic interests in the Meru, Meru, KE region.
Graduate Data Analyst - Machine Learning Specialization
Posted 9 days ago
Job Viewed
Job Description
Responsibilities:
- Assist in the collection, cleaning, and preprocessing of large datasets from various sources.
- Perform exploratory data analysis to identify trends, patterns, and anomalies.
- Support the development and implementation of machine learning models under the guidance of senior team members.
- Conduct literature reviews on relevant machine learning techniques and algorithms.
- Assist in the evaluation and validation of model performance.
- Develop data visualizations and reports to communicate findings to the team.
- Collaborate with team members on data-related tasks and projects.
- Learn and apply statistical methods and machine learning algorithms.
- Participate in team meetings and contribute to discussions on project progress and strategy.
- Gain practical experience with programming languages like Python and relevant libraries (e.g., Pandas, NumPy, Scikit-learn, TensorFlow/PyTorch).
Qualifications:
- Recent graduate with a Bachelor's or Master's degree in Computer Science, Statistics, Mathematics, Engineering, or a related quantitative field.
- Strong foundation in statistical concepts and data analysis principles.
- Basic understanding of machine learning concepts and algorithms.
- Proficiency in at least one programming language, preferably Python.
- Familiarity with data manipulation and analysis libraries (e.g., Pandas, NumPy).
- Excellent analytical and problem-solving skills.
- Strong attention to detail and accuracy.
- Good communication and interpersonal skills, with the ability to work effectively in a remote team environment.
- Eagerness to learn and adapt to new technologies and methodologies.
- A genuine interest in data science, machine learning, and artificial intelligence.
Be The First To Know
About the latest Predictive models Jobs in Kenya !
Graduate Data Analyst - Machine Learning Focus
Posted 19 days ago
Job Viewed
Job Description
Key Responsibilities:
- Assist in the collection, cleaning, and preprocessing of large datasets for analysis.
- Support the development and implementation of machine learning models under the guidance of senior staff.
- Perform exploratory data analysis to identify patterns, trends, and anomalies.
- Create data visualizations and reports to communicate findings effectively.
- Conduct statistical analysis and hypothesis testing.
- Collaborate with the data science team on various research and development projects.
- Document methodologies, code, and results clearly and concisely.
- Assist in the evaluation and validation of model performance.
- Learn and apply new data analysis techniques and tools.
- Participate in team meetings and contribute to project discussions.
- Recent graduate with a Bachelor's or Master's degree in Data Science, Statistics, Computer Science, Mathematics, Economics, or a related quantitative field.
- Strong foundation in statistical concepts and analytical techniques.
- Basic understanding of machine learning algorithms and principles.
- Proficiency in at least one programming language commonly used in data analysis (e.g., Python, R).
- Familiarity with data manipulation libraries (e.g., Pandas, NumPy).
- Experience with data visualization tools (e.g., Matplotlib, Seaborn, Tableau) is a plus.
- Excellent problem-solving and critical-thinking abilities.
- Strong attention to detail and accuracy.
- Good communication and teamwork skills, essential for remote collaboration.
- Enthusiasm for learning and a proactive attitude.
Junior Graduate Analyst - Data Science and Analytics
Posted 19 days ago
Job Viewed
Job Description
Responsibilities:
- Assist in collecting, cleaning, and organizing large datasets from various sources.
- Perform basic data analysis and generate reports under the guidance of senior analysts.
- Develop and maintain data visualizations to help communicate insights effectively.
- Support the development of dashboards and reports using business intelligence tools.
- Conduct research on industry trends and competitive landscape to inform analytical projects.
- Collaborate with team members on ad-hoc data analysis requests.
- Learn and apply statistical methods and data modeling techniques.
- Participate in team meetings and contribute ideas for data-driven solutions.
- Assist in documenting data sources, methodologies, and findings.
- Gain exposure to programming languages commonly used in data analysis, such as Python or R.
- Recent graduate with a Bachelor's or Master's degree in a quantitative field such as Statistics, Mathematics, Computer Science, Economics, Data Science, or a related discipline.
- Strong analytical and problem-solving skills.
- Proficiency in Microsoft Excel for data manipulation and analysis.
- Basic understanding of statistical concepts and data analysis principles.
- Familiarity with data visualization tools (e.g., Tableau, Power BI) is a plus.
- Exposure to programming languages like Python or R is highly desirable.
- Excellent written and verbal communication skills.
- Ability to work independently and manage tasks effectively in a remote setting.
- Eagerness to learn and a strong work ethic.
- Enthusiasm for data and analytics.
Remote Work: AI Data Annotation Specialist
Posted today
Job Viewed
Job Description
About the Role:
Help shape the future of AI We're seeking detail-oriented freelancers to join a global AI data annotation project. As an AI Data Annotation Specialist, you'll annotate, label, and curate data that powers advanced machine learning models. Your work—tagging images, labeling text, or collecting documents—will directly impact the accuracy and performance of AI systems used worldwide.
Key Responsibilities:
- Annotate & Label: Tag, categorize, and review text, images, and documents.
- Collect Data: Gather and organize high-quality datasets for AI training.
- Ensure Quality: Review and validate data for precision and consistency.
- Collaborate Globally: Work with an international team to hit project milestones.
Basic Requirements:
- Strong attention to detail and ability to follow precise instructions.
- Reliable internet connection and ability to work independently.
- Prior experience in data annotation or labeling is a plus but not required.
- Basic understanding of AI or machine learning concepts is advantageous.
- Strong proficiency in English for clear communication and reporting.